WATCH: Rescued Israeli hostages reunited with loved ones

Two freed Israeli hostages were reunited with their families after Israeli forces rescued them early Monday by storming an apartment in Rafah, in the southern Gaza Strip. » Subscribe to NBC News: https://www.youtube.com/user/NBCNews NBC News Digital is a collection of innovative and powerful news brands that deliver compelling, diverse and engaging news stories.
